Ok, since I've had my Imac I've been venturing to try software
packages which didn't work too well on my Power PC, one of these is
the VLC Media Player, the Intel build seems to work far better than
did the Power PC build. The reason I raise the subject of VLC is
because I'm sure other list members use it and also because it has a
very similar feel to use to Winamp, one of our list members was
commenting on this a few weeks ago when he talked about the
thundermental differences between the way Itunes and Winamp work.
As we all know, Itunes is based round a library of content whereas
Winamp and VLC are based on playlists, to further illustrate the
point if you select all the songs in a folder, have VLC set as your
default media player and then press say command-down arrow to open
the selection, then all files are played with VLC and you can save a
playlist reflecting the songs you selected to play, no files are
moved or copied anywhere and you put the playlist where you want it
so that's just plain and simple.
